在当今互联网时代,GitHub作为一个重要的代码托管平台,已经成为全球开发者的重要工具。然而,很多用户在新疆地区却发现无法顺利访问GitHub。本文将详细探讨这一问题的原因及解决方案。
1. 新疆地区访问GitHub的问题
1.1 网络限制
新疆由于其特殊的地理和政治环境,网络访问受到了一定的限制。这些限制可能导致许多网站,包括GitHub,在该地区无法访问。
1.2 DNS问题
有些用户可能会遭遇DNS解析失败的问题,这可能使得GitHub的域名无法正确解析,从而无法访问。
1.3 运营商限制
不同的网络运营商在数据传输方面的政策也会影响用户的访问体验。有些运营商可能会对特定的网站设置访问限制,GitHub可能就是其中之一。
2. 访问GitHub的可能原因
2.1 政策因素
中国的网络政策和相关法律法规可能会影响GitHub在新疆的访问。在某些时段或特殊情况下,GitHub的部分功能或内容可能会被屏蔽。
2.2 服务器问题
有时,GitHub的服务器可能会出现故障或维护,从而影响所有用户的访问,包括新疆的用户。
2.3 VPN和代理的影响
使用VPN或代理服务可以改变用户的IP地址,从而影响访问GitHub的可能性。然而,这种方法并不总是可靠,并可能受到法律限制。
3. 如何解决新疆访问GitHub的问题
3.1 使用VPN
使用可靠的VPN服务可以帮助用户绕过地区限制,实现对GitHub的访问。建议选择知名且评价高的VPN提供商。
3.2 更改DNS设置
用户可以尝试使用公共DNS,如Google DNS(8.8.8.8)或Cloudflare DNS(1.1.1.1),来提高DNS解析速度。
3.3 代理设置
通过设置HTTP或SOCKS代理,可以改变流量的传输路径,帮助用户访问被限制的网站。
3.4 联系运营商
如果用户怀疑是运营商造成的访问问题,可以尝试联系网络运营商,了解相关政策。
4. 常见问题解答
4.1 新疆真的无法访问GitHub吗?
并不是所有用户都无法访问GitHub,有些用户可能在特定时间或特定网络环境下能访问,具体情况可能因人而异。
4.2 使用VPN安全可靠吗?
使用知名的VPN服务提供商通常是安全的,但用户仍需确保其服务符合当地法律法规。
4.3 如果我无法解决访问问题怎么办?
如果经过多次尝试仍无法访问,建议使用其他代码托管平台或寻求专业人士的帮助。
4.4 使用GitHub Desktop应用能否解决问题?
GitHub Desktop应用在访问上可能受到同样的限制,因此可能无法解决访问问题。
5. 结论
在新疆访问GitHub的困难主要源于网络限制和其他政策因素。通过使用VPN、改变DNS设置等方法,可以有效改善访问体验。希望本文能为广大新疆用户提供实用的解决方案。